San Pablo Burgos has secured its first signing for the 2026/2027 Liga Endesa season, announcing the addition of Slovenian point guard Ziga Samar. The 1.97-meter player, who holds a homegrown player license, brings a wealth of experience from Spain's top basketball division.
Samar's career includes two seasons with Baloncesto Fuenlabrada and the last two with Dreamland Gran Canaria. He has established himself as a regular in the Spanish league and is also a consistent member of the Slovenian national team. His development began in the youth ranks of Union Olimpija Ljubljana before he moved to Spain in 2017 to join Real Madrid's academy.
After his time at Real Madrid, Samar played a season in LEB Plata with CB Zamora, followed by his ACB debut with Baloncesto Fuenlabrada from 2020 to 2022. His career then took him to Germany, where he played for Hamburg Towers and Alba Berlin. In January 2025, he was loaned to Dreamland Gran Canaria, where he has spent the last two seasons.
With Samar's signing, San Pablo Burgos aims to build a competitive project for the 2026/27 season, acquiring a young player who is familiar with Spanish basketball and possesses international experience.
